Safe and affordable housing is out of reach for too many Idaho families, and we all pay the price when rents are too high. Idaho Sen. Mike Crapo is working to alleviate these housing challenges through the introduction of the Renewing Opportunity in the American Dream to Housing Act. This bipartisan package includes long-term policy solutions that are needed to address our state’s housing challenges — including more than 40 provisions aimed at cutting red tape to access federal housing assistance, building more homes and updating outdated programs.
